I do the same add them to my free range flock. Let them grow out then put them in the freezer. They get to live a good life on 8 acres till there culled. And sometimes I keep one if it has a special personality I just can't help it.I eat them, add them to my free range bachelor coop (in which case they may still get eaten) or sell them off with excess pullets in pairs and trios. Occasionally I have someone looking for just a cockerel, but not often. Pullets here aren't sold without a cockerel unless I manage to get rid of all the boys and still have extra girls left over (doesn't happen very often).
